Skip to content

Conversation

@xLPMG
Copy link
Contributor

@xLPMG xLPMG commented Dec 4, 2025

Added a connection for artIntensity to ConstellationMgr::artIntensityChanged

Type of change

  • Bug fix (non-breaking change which fixes an issue)
  • New feature (non-breaking change which adds functionality)
  • Breaking change (fix or feature that would cause existing functionality to change)
  • This change requires a documentation update
  • Housekeeping
  • [ ]

Checklist:

  • My code follows the code style of this project.
  • I have performed a self-review of my own code
  • I have commented my code, particularly in hard-to-understand areas
  • I have made corresponding changes to the documentation (header file)
  • I have updated the respective chapter in the Stellarium User Guide
  • My changes generate no new warnings
  • I have added tests that prove my fix is effective or that my feature works
  • New and existing unit tests pass locally with my changes
  • Any dependent changes have been merged and published in downstream modules

@xLPMG xLPMG changed the title SCM: Use artIntensity from ConstellationMgr and add nullptr guards SCM: Use artIntensity from ConstellationMgr Dec 4, 2025
@alex-w alex-w added this to the 25.4 milestone Dec 5, 2025
@alex-w alex-w added the subsystem: plugins The issue is related to plugins of planetarium... label Dec 5, 2025
Copy link
Member

@gzotti gzotti left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Seems OK for me.

@gzotti gzotti merged commit e024f59 into Stellarium:master Dec 6, 2025
17 checks passed
@github-project-automation github-project-automation bot moved this from Backlog to Done in Plugin: Sky Culture Maker Dec 6, 2025
@xLPMG xLPMG deleted the scm-art-intensity-connection branch December 6, 2025 14:34
@alex-w alex-w added the state: published The fix has been published for testing in weekly binary package label Dec 8, 2025
@github-actions
Copy link

github-actions bot commented Dec 8, 2025

Hello @xLPMG!

Please check the fresh version (development snapshot) of Stellarium:
https://github.com/Stellarium/stellarium-data/releases/tag/weekly-snapshot

@alex-w alex-w removed the state: published The fix has been published for testing in weekly binary package label Dec 29, 2025
@github-actions
Copy link

Hello @xLPMG!

Please check the latest stable version of Stellarium:
https://github.com/Stellarium/stellarium/releases/latest

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

subsystem: plugins The issue is related to plugins of planetarium...

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

4 participants